Hey — quick handover on Spokeshift, our bike-share rebalancing tool. The solver runs every 20 minutes and pushes van routes to the Dockside dispatch app. If routes look weird, it's usually stale station inventory; just re-trigger the ingest job. Heads up: the Harborview district has a manual override that bypasses the solver entirely. Docs are thin, sorry — ping the channel with questions. Ongoing ownership sits with the person named below.

approver of yajef-fajef = Oliwyn Silion Kasok Kasox

// Turnstile counter client for the Braxton Field gate system.
// Reads per-gate tick counts from the Gatewise aggregator every 30s
// and reconciles against the ticketing ledger before publishing
// occupancy to the ops dashboard. Release managers: do not ship
// without verifying the reconciliation window is 30s, not 60s.
// The aggregator authenticates using the key that follows.

app token of yajeg-kawef = kto11_7En3XSX8xQw

## Deployment

The revamped password reset flow for Ferngate Accounts ships as a separate service from the legacy mailer. Deploys go through the Bramblehook pipeline: staging first, then a 24-hour soak before prod. New team members should never deploy both services simultaneously, as token formats differ between them. Before your first deploy, verify your environment matches the configuration values below.

settings of tagef-bawif:
DRUIX_HOST=druix.zemvarlabs.internal
DRUIX_PORT=8000